Embarking on the adventure of cultivating Lophophora Williamsii, commonly known as peyote, is a fascinating experience for the dedicated gardener. These resilient succulents, native to the arid regions of North America, thrive in ideal conditions and offer a glimpse into the beauty of the desert ecosystem. From small seeds, peyote plants develop over time, showcasing their unique features.

  • Start your propagation process by planting the tiny seeds in a well-draining soil.
  • Provide plenty of filtered sunlight to help the seedlings thrive.
  • Moisturize your peyote plants sparingly, as they are adapted to survive in dry conditions.

With patience and proper care, you'll witness the slow but steady growth of these remarkable succulents. Over time, Lophophora Williamsii plants become into distinct specimens with their characteristic form. Remember to provide them with a hospitable environment that mimics their natural habitat to ensure their survival.
